Abstract
Just as the emergence of personal computers and smartphones has changed the life of modern society, the Internet of Things, augmented reality and ultra-fast and reliable telecommunications networks of the new generation, by combining the physical objects of the real world with the ever-increasing computing power and intelligence of cyberspace, will make the next big revolution in all spheres of human activity.
